feat: disabled mode (TENACIOUSLOAD_DISABLED=1) — no-op but keep the loading bar
A one-flag kill-switch: when set, the pack installs no middleware, registers no refresh routes, computes no fingerprint and exposes no graph node — ComfyUI runs exactly as if it weren't installed. Only the read-only /tenaciousload/status route stays so the loading-screen overlay still shows (a generic 'Loading node definitions…' bar, since there's no build to track). The refresh menu buttons hide themselves when status reports enabled:false. Useful for A/B testing or as a safety kill-switch. Requires a restart (the middleware is installed at startup).
